•  The following holy days occur:

2/2    The Presentation of Jesus in the Temple

2/3    Anskar, missionary to Denmark c. 855

2/4    Cornelius the Centurion

2/5    The Martyrs of Japan

2/13   Absolom Jones, African American priest, d 1818

2/14   Cyril and Methodius, brothers,

missionaries to the Slavs, 19th Century

2/15   Thomas Bray, priest & missionary to

Maryland, d 1730

2/23    Polycarp, Bishop & Martyr of Smyrna, d. 156

2/24    St. Matthias the Apostle

2/27    George Herbert, priest and poet, d. 1633

•  Lent usually begins in February (this year Ash Wednesday is February 22) and it is preceded by  Shrove Tuesday.
